Socio-cultural learning and Aboriginal adult English LLN delivery

A case study commissioned by the Australian Government funded Whole of Community Engagement initiative (led by Charles Darwin University) documents Yuendumu communities’ experience of literacy development and socio-cultural learning.  The case study has been written to inform discussion and debate, and inspire evidence based action around adult English LLN in the Northern Territory.  We are pleased to share it with you here

A socio-cultural model of literacy provision is underpinned by current social and cultural practices, and local delivery matched to people’s real-life needs, preferences and realities.  This report strongly suggests that the local learning centre model is key to improvement of Aboriginal literacy, to the embedding of literacy and the maintenance of learning over time.
